Gathering a handful of basic ingredients is all it takes to create these delightful pastries. Each component plays a special role, contributing to the filling’s rich creaminess, the fruit’s fresh sweetness, and the crust’s buttery crispness.

  • Puff pastry sheet (1 sheet, 8.6 oz): This is your golden, flaky base that holds everything together beautifully.
  • Cream cheese (2 oz, softened): Provides a luscious, tangy layer that balances the sweetness perfectly.
  • Strawberry jam (1 1/2 Tbsp): Adds concentrated fruity flavor and a touch of natural sweetness.
  • Red food coloring (1 drop, optional): Enhances the vibrant color of the cream cheese mixture for visual appeal.
  • Very small diced strawberries (2/3 cup): Fresh fruit pieces add juicy bursts and vibrant texture to each bite.
  • Large egg (1, whisked with 1 Tbsp water): This egg wash helps create that gorgeous golden crust on the pastries.
  • Powdered sugar (for dusting): A delicate finishing touch that adds a bit of sparkle and sweetness.

How to Make Strawberry Cream Cheese Breakfast Pastries Recipe

Step 1: Prepare Your Puff Pastry and Oven

Start by thawing your puff pastry as directed on the package for a perfectly workable dough. Halfway through thawing, preheat your oven to 400 degrees Fahrenheit, ensuring it’s nice and hot to bake those pastries to golden perfection.

Step 2: Mix the Cream Cheese Filling

While waiting for the dough, blend softened cream cheese with strawberry jam in a small bowl. For a pop of color, add a drop of red food coloring or beet powder. Use a rubber spatula to press the mixture against the bowl’s edges, smoothing out any lumps for a silky consistency, then chill it briefly to firm up before spreading.

Step 3: Cut Puff Pastry Into Hearts

With a 3-inch heart-shaped cookie cutter, cut as many heart shapes as possible from your sheet, positioning them tightly to maximize your yield. Transfer each heart to a lined baking sheet with about 1 1/2 inches of space between to allow for puffing up.

Step 4: Score the Hearts

Using a sharp paring knife, lightly score a smaller heart inside each pastry heart about 1/3 inch from the edge. Be careful not to cut all the way through. This scoring allows the edges to puff up, creating a charming raised border around your filling.

Step 5: Add Cream Cheese and Strawberries

Spoon about one teaspoon of the cream cheese mixture into each heart, gently spreading it toward the edges but not over the scored border. Sprinkle the finely diced strawberries on top, again keeping inside the edge. This layering is key for that perfect bite of creamy and fruity goodness.

Step 6: Apply Egg Wash and Bake

Brush the exposed 1/3-inch edge of each pastry with the egg wash mixture. This step ensures a beautifully golden and glossy crust once baked. Place the tray in your preheated oven and bake for 14 to 15 minutes, until the edges are puffed and sun-kissed golden.

Step 7: Cool and Dust

Remove your pastries from the oven and set them on a wire rack to cool slightly. Finish with a light dusting of powdered sugar for an elegant, sweet finale just before serving.

Make Ahead and Storage

Storing Leftovers

If you’re lucky enough to have leftovers, store them in an airtight container at room temperature for up to one day. After that, the puff pastry may lose its crispness, so best enjoyed fresh!

Freezing

These pastries freeze wonderfully before baking. Simply prepare the hearts, fill them, and freeze on a tray until solid. Then transfer to a freezer bag and keep for up to a month. Bake straight from frozen, adding a few extra minutes to the baking time.

Reheating

To bring back that fresh-baked flakiness, warm leftover pastries in a preheated oven at 350 degrees Fahrenheit for about 5 to 7 minutes. Microwaving is not recommended as it hardens the pastry.

FAQs

Can I use frozen strawberries instead of fresh?

Fresh strawberries give the best texture and flavor, but if you use frozen, be sure to thaw and drain them well to avoid soggy pastries.

Is there a substitute for puff pastry?

While puff pastry gives the signature flakiness, you could try croissant dough for a more buttery flavor, though it may change the texture.

How do I prevent the cream cheese mixture from making the pastry soggy?

Chilling the cream cheese mixture before assembling and avoiding spreading it over the puffed edge helps keep the pastry crisp.

Can I make these pastries vegan?

Yes! Use a plant-based cream cheese and egg substitute like aquafaba for the wash, and make sure your puff pastry is dairy-free.

How many pastries does this recipe make?

You can get approximately nine heart-shaped pastries from one sheet of puff pastry, perfect for sharing or a small gathering.

Ingredients

Pastry

  • 1 (8.6 oz) sheet puff pastry

Filling

  • 2 oz cream cheese, softened
  • 1 1/2 Tbsp strawberry jam
  • 1 drop red food coloring (or use beet powder), optional
  • 2/3 cup very small diced strawberries

Egg Wash

  • 1 large egg, whisked with 1 Tbsp water

Finishing

  • Powdered sugar, for dusting

Instructions

  1. Prepare Puff Pastry and Oven: Thaw the puff pastry sheet according to the package instructions. Halfway through thawing, preheat your oven to 400°F (204°C) to ensure it’s hot and ready when the pastries are assembled.
  2. Make the Cream Cheese Filling: In a small bowl, combine softened cream cheese, strawberry jam, and optional red food coloring. Use a rubber spatula to mix and press the mixture against the bottom and sides of the bowl to smooth out any lumps. Chill the mixture in the refrigerator or quickly in the freezer to firm it up before using.
  3. Cut Puff Pastry Hearts: Once thawed, use a 3-inch heart-shaped cookie cutter to cut out heart shapes from the puff pastry. Place them as close together on the sheet to maximize the number of hearts you can get.
  4. Place Hearts on Baking Sheet: Transfer the cut-out hearts to a baking sheet lined with silicone baking mat or parchment paper, spacing them about 1 1/2 inches apart to allow room for puffing.
  5. Score the Pastry Hearts: Use a sharp paring knife to gently score a smaller heart inside each pastry heart, about 1/3 inch from the edge. Be careful not to cut all the way through the dough; this will help the edges rise higher while baking.
  6. Fill with Cream Cheese Mixture: Spoon approximately 1 teaspoon of the cream cheese filling into the center of each heart. Spread it outward gently, leaving the 1/3-inch edge free of filling to ensure proper puffing.
  7. Add Strawberries: Sprinkle the very small diced strawberries evenly on top of the cream cheese filling, again not covering the 1/3-inch edge of the pastry.
  8. Brush Edges with Egg Wash: Using your fingertip or a pastry brush, lightly brush the exposed 1/3-inch edge of each heart with the whisked egg and water mixture. This will give the edges a beautiful golden color when baked.
  9. Bake the Pastries: Place the baking sheet in the preheated oven and bake the pastries for 14 to 15 minutes, or until the edges are puffed and golden brown.
  10. Cool and Serve: Remove the pastries from the oven and let them cool on a wire rack. Once cooled, dust the tops with powdered sugar. Serve the pastries the same day for the best texture and flavor.

Notes

  • Make sure the puff pastry is properly thawed but still cold for easy cutting and shaping.
  • Use a sharp cookie cutter and paring knife to get clean shapes and neat scoring on the dough.
  • You can substitute any berry jam if you prefer flavors other than strawberry.
  • Fresh small diced strawberries are key for the best texture and sweetness.
  • Serve pastries fresh; they are best enjoyed the day they are made to maintain flakiness.
  • For a vegan version, use dairy-free cream cheese and egg substitute for wash, but baking times may vary slightly.
